style: Migrate to stable-only rustfmt configuration
- Remove nightly-only features from .rustfmt.toml and vendor/ss58-registry/rustfmt.toml - Removed features: imports_granularity, wrap_comments, comment_width, reorder_impl_items, spaces_around_ranges, binop_separator, match_arm_blocks, trailing_semicolon, trailing_comma - Format all 898 affected files with stable rustfmt - Ensures long-term reliability without nightly toolchain dependency
